The first staff meeting of the “Poppy-2014” operation was held today, 19 May, in Tajikistan’s Drug Control Agency.
According to the Drug-Control Agency, the meeting was chaired by the First Deputy Head of the Agency, the Head of Operations, Major-General Vaysiddin Azamatov.
Organizational issues on conducting “Poppy-2014” were reviewed, as well as collaboration between ministries and other relevant structures.
The source said: “Plan of action for Poppy-2014 was approved, which included such points as organization of collaboration between law-enforcement agencies with the aim of organizing joint actions on closing drug channels; compilation of information on illicit trafficking in plant-origin drugs, as well as finding the sites under the operational area; monitoring the exercise of prescriptions; finding and destroying wild narcotics; holding explanatory work among the population.”
According to him, Ministry of Interior, National Security Committee, and Customs Services representatives participated in the meeting.
The Agencies information says: “An international operation, dubbed Channel, is supposed to be held within the frame of Poppy operation. The operation is held annually in Tajikistan. This year the operation will begin on 20 May and end of 30 November.”
